What happens when a hard drive fails? If you have a HDD, it’s not so much a question of if, but when. This is why most experts recommend some kind of redundancy be built into the system, so that you can go on working without losing any data. But what about the defunct drive? Now that it’s malfunctioning, you can’t just erase it via software. And even if you could, that’s not a very secure way of rendering your data unsalvageable.

Just because the drive won’t function (head crash, etc.), doesn’t make your HDD safe to simply toss out. Anyone with enough resources can still read your inoperative drive–those platters, with all their 1s and 0s of valuable data, could still be readable and could be transferred to a new unit. Someone could still easily read them.

You need a way of ensuring that your most valuable and private data is protected. There’s nothing that does that so well as the physical destruction of the drive.
